<h2 class="wp-block-heading" id="h-the-true-ai-revolution-isn-t-productivity-it-s-accessibility">The True AI Revolution Isn&#8217;t Productivity. It&#8217;s Accessibility. </h2>



<p>We often focus on AI for efficiency gains. But for the 61 million American adults (or 1 in 4) with a disability, AI offers something far more vital: the ability to participate fully. Those who are differently abled represent &#8220;the world&#8217;s largest minority,&#8221; and they, along with underserved populations, face systemic barriers. This report moves beyond the hype to show how AI is transforming these obstacles into inclusive, accessible experiences for everyone.&nbsp;</p>



<p>Key Takeaways:</p>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>The business of inclusion is booming, with the U.S. AI in accessibility market reaching $1.43 Billion and projected to grow at a 24.4% CAGR, driven largely by Natural Language Processing (NLP). </li>
</ul>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>AI serves as a crucial bridge for diverse groups, delivering personalized solutions for physical and cognitive disabilities as well as providing equity for underserved, low-income, and rural populations. </li>
</ul>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>The future of accessibility requires vigilance and human oversight to combat data bias and a current lack of representation in AI design, which only 7% of surveyed users feel is adequate. </li>
</ul>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2>Inclusive Learning: The Human Factor in Emerging Tech</h2><p>In this report, Jane Bozarth explores the role of humans in leveraging emerging technologies, particularly AI, for inclusive learning. While acknowledging AI&#8217;s potential to enhance collaboration, engagement, and interactivity, it emphasizes that human designers and facilitators are crucial for successful implementation. The report argues that humans, not just AI, are responsible for shaping applications and even teaching the machines. It concludes that despite the exciting AI-powered future, human agency remains key.&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;</p><p><em>&ldquo;Aligning experiences with capabilities and providing tailored paths unique to individuals promote a sense of ownership and empowerment, which in turn can help promote motivation, engagement, and persistence.&rdquo;&nbsp;&nbsp;</em></p><p>This report walks us through how several emerging technologies have helped make learning more accessible, including:&nbsp;&nbsp;</p><ul class="wp-block-list"><li><p>Artificial Intelligence (AI)&nbsp;&nbsp;</p></li><li><p>Machine Learning&nbsp;&nbsp;</p></li><li><p>Gamification &amp; Serious Games&nbsp;&nbsp;</p></li><li><p>3D Printing&nbsp;&nbsp;</p></li><li><p>Cloud Computing&nbsp;&nbsp;</p></li><li><p>Mobile Learning Apps&nbsp;&nbsp;</p></li><li><p>Internet of Things (IoT)&nbsp;&nbsp;</p></li><li><p>And more&nbsp;&nbsp;</p></li></ul><p>Important considerations like data security, privacy, and the ethics of personalized instruction, while relevant, were outside the scope of this report. 										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A chatbot can play many roles in the learning journey to support performance and guide learners. Being inexpensive to deploy, chatbots can support thousands of people simultaneously, saving companies time and money on their training efforts. In Chatbots for Learning, Vince Han walks us through the current scope of how chatbots operate in today&#8217;s corporate setting and offers advice for introducing them to your own learning strategy.&nbsp;</p><p>Key takeaways include:&nbsp;</p><ul class="wp-block-list"><li><p>Rules-based chatbots vs. AI-driven chatbots&nbsp;</p></li><li><p>Chatbot hallucinations and why you should avoid them&nbsp;&nbsp;</p></li><li><p>Security and privacy considerations&nbsp;</p></li><li><p>Advice for getting stakeholder buy-in for implementing chatbots&nbsp;</p></li></ul><p>The post <a href="https://www.learningguild.com/research/chatbots-for-learning">Chatbots for Learning</a> appeared first on <a href="https://www.learningguild.com">Learning Guild</a>.</p>
